 packagekit-0.2.3+git0+813fa8cfb139246cf180d52895b52b28616ae2f5-r9.03,
 which is the revision compiled by org.openmoko.dev, needs a recent
 revision of opkg because it calls opkg_repository_accessibility_check() on
 backends/opkg/pk-backend-opkg.c. That function was added on r4528, which
 is less than the r4558 found on conf/distro/include/sane-srcrevs.inc;
 however, there is a couple of lines in conf/distro/include/preferred-
 om-2008-versions.inc which override that and force the SRCREV of opkg to
 be 4488, thus making the packagekit compile fail.

 The fix is simply to comment out both SRCREV lines at conf/distro/include
 /preferred-om-2008-versions.inc, letting the lines at sane-srcrevs.inc
 determine the revision to be used.

 I'm running 2007.02.

 I've applied mwester's fixes to fix sound breakage during suspend/resume.
 It was working all fine.. Until suddenly I see that the screen remains
 blank (after suspend I suppose). The display did not come up no matter
 what.

 But the device was accessible through ssh and I did a dmesg and saw a lot
 of 'pcf50633_battvolt timeout :-('. And apm -s gives 'Device or resource
 busy'. I had to reboot to fix this.
